Coming from a farming tradition in Araku, this farmer tends to a two-acre plot inherited from his father, who once cultivated pulses & millets, and turmeric. While this farmer converted the plot to grow coffee, he cultivated it without ever fully understanding it. The coffee bushes in his plot were weak; the soil dry, and lifeless; and the yield was uncertain. Stripping the cherries, regardless of ripeness, also affected the bush's health and yield, reducing both for next year.

All this changed when he joined Naandi in 2015. The use of bioinputs, compost applications, and soil-enhancing practices, like mulching, helped the coffee bush grow healthy and restore soil health. Slowly, the plot began to respond, the soil became richer with earthworms and microbes, better moisture retention, and the bushes became healthier with juicier coffee cherries.

The farmer reflects his journey’s simple truth: “as humans need food, vitamins, and minerals to remain strong, coffee bushes, too, need nutrient-rich topsoil to grow and produce quality cherries.”
